✦ Synopsis


Abstract

An integrated flow‐injection processing (FIP) system for the quantification of plasmids during cultivation is described. The system performs on‐line sampling, cell lysis, and quantification of plasmids in an integrated manner during cultivation of E. coli. The system was operated by using a miniaturized expanded‐bed column which can be used for handling samples containing cells and cell debris without interfering with the binding analysis. Two types of detectors (one measuring UV absorbance at 254 nm and a fluorometer) are used for on‐line plasmid detection. The system was developed using standard solutions and it was successfully applied in monitoring plasmid contents during a cultivation of E. coli. © 2001 John Wiley & Sons, Inc. Biotechnol Bioeng 73: 406–411, 2001.
